It is with profound sadness that we share the news of the passing of Coach Bill Fox. Coach Fox was a longtime faculty member and served as our Head Basketball Coach for almost 30 seasons (read a career tribute by Ted Silary here: http://www.tedsilary.com/billfox.htm). Over the course of his illustrious teaching and coaching career at Father Judge, he led by example and was the epitome of a Salesian Gentlemen. Countless Judge Guys benefited from his guidance and mentorship - in the classroom and on the court. The Markward Club would like to extend their condolences to the family and friends of Joe Kiernan, a longtime member and supporter of the club. May he Rest In Peace. Joe's service and life celebration are this Saturday, July 10th, and our family would like the followers of the Markward Club to be aware of his passing and have the information to pay their respects should they wish. Joe dedicated so much of his energy towards all causes surrounding Coach Markward and the Clu...b, including the publishing of two books, being one of the forces behind getting him into the Philadelphia Sports Hall of Fame, and the significant & continued efforts by Joe, RCHS and Saint Joseph's University to appeal to the Naismith Basketball Hall of Fame for consideration. We, and the Club were lucky to have had a man so passionate about Coach Markward and the ongoing efforts of the Markward Club. Here is the link to the obituary.
